How Can You Maintain Your Backpack Tree Stand for Optimal Performance and Longevity?
To maintain your backpack tree stand for optimal performance and longevity, regularly inspect it, clean it, store it properly, and check its components for wear and tear.
Regular inspections are crucial. Look for any signs of damage or wear on straps, hooks, and platforms. Ensure all bolts and screws are tight. A study by the Journal of Wildlife Management (Smith, 2021) emphasized that equipment safety can prevent accidents during hunting.
Cleaning your stand helps prevent deterioration. Use a mild soap and water solution to remove dirt, sap, and moisture. Dry the stand thoroughly before storage. A clean stand reduces corrosion risk, extending its lifespan.
Proper storage protects your stand from environmental damage. Store it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and moisture. If you keep it outdoors, cover it with a waterproof tarp to shield it from rain and snow.
Check components for wear and tear. Inspect ropes, straps, and metal parts for fraying, rust, or bends. Replace any damaged components immediately.
